**Job Description**:
The Bilingual Media Assistant is an important member of the Planning team which pursues and activates against meaningful insights with the goal of driving measurable results. Planning Assistants receive in-depth training and continue their professional development by gaining experience and skills via on-the job experience. The Planning Assistant’s key skills-set includes analytical skills, math proficiency, demonstrated creative thinking, and great attention to detail.

**Responsibilities**
- Assist the Planners and Supervisors in managing and executing approved media plans (all media).
- Assist in the development and organization of supportive data for plans and recommendations.
- May often communicate with local Field clients regarding tactical aspects of the media plans and to assist in facilitating information and answering questions.
- Manage contracts/ insertion orders and any resulting revisions with media vendors.
- Responsible for inputting non-broadcast/OLV media buys and managing any discrepancy reconciliations including actualizing media spending
- Assist with billing process.
- Responsible for updating blocking charts, budgets, and budget summaries,
- Assist with media research and day-to-day communication with creative account team members as appropriate.
- Update competitive media reports and technical support for presentation materials.
